Abby Spencer 1853–1940 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 01 Oct 1853

Birth Location: New Vineyard, Franklin, Maine, USA

Death Date: Jul 1940

Death Location: South Pasadena, Los Angeles, California, USA

Father: James Spencer

Mother: Martha Spencer

Spouse(s): A. Gilbert, Henry Mourer

Children(s):

Abby Spencer was born in 1853 in New Vineyard, Franklin, Maine, USA, the child of James E Spencer And Martha Spencer. Abby Spencer married A G Gilbert, Henry Mourer. Abby Spencer passed away in 1940 in South Pasadena, Los Angeles, California, USA.
